In terms of branching out, was her Jaran series SF based? Or SF-Fantasy at any rate? (I’ve always been meaning to read it but havena got there yet.)
The Jaran series is much more science fiction, and it presents an entirely fascinating look at what could happen when an extremely advanced, space-able race meets a complicated but undeveloped world. You get both steppe nomads and space ships! It’s Elliot-esque anthropology at its best.
